Handover — Vexler partner SFTP drop

Ownership moves to you today. Drop runs hourly from Vexler's end into the intake bucket via the relay host. Watch for zero-byte files; their exporter flakes on Mondays. Creds live in the ops vault, path noted in the runbook. Vault auto-seals after 48h idle. Support escalations go to the on-call rotation, not me. If the vault is sealed when you need it, unseal with the recovery passphrase below.

recovery phrase for tadug-fafof: zorwyn-kasion

Step 7: Review pool settings before promoting the Corvane API. Max pool size is 40 per instance; confirm the new replica count keeps total connections under the Postgres limit of 400. Check that idle timeout is 300s and that leak detection is enabled. Reject the change if migrations hold connections outside a transaction. After approval, sign the release manifest with the key below.

rollout seal: bky4_x7Gc

Step 3 of rolling out TidyTwig, our stale-branch cleanup bot. Before you approve this, double-check that the dry-run output in the pipeline logs only lists branches older than 90 days — we've nuked an active branch before and nobody enjoyed that week. Once you're happy, the bot needs push access to perform deletions, which it authenticates with the deploy key below.

rollout seal: bky6_MeoCCt

## Service Account: routematch-heuristic

The driver-assignment heuristic in Fleetwhistle runs under the `svc-routematch` account. It scores available drivers by proximity and shift fatigue, then writes assignments to the Dispatchboard API. Scope is read-only on driver rosters and write-only on the assignment queue; no PII fields are accessible. Token rotation occurs quarterly via the Keysmith pipeline. For audit purposes, the current key used by the heuristic is recorded below.

API key for yahig-tadup: kto7_ubizbYm

## Deploying the Gatewick Proctor Queue

Deploys are pretty painless: push to main, wait for the pipeline, then watch the queue drain dashboard for five minutes. If candidates pile up mid-exam, roll back first and ask questions later — the queue replays safely. Everything the workers care about lives in one config block, shown here for reference.

settings of bafof-yagef:
JOROX_PIN=8740
JOROX_TENANT=pelox
JOROX_METRICS_HOST=metrics.jorox.qorvelworks.internal
JOROX_SEAL=seal_c78f63c1
JOROX_STANDBY_TEAM=norax